Output 96a5e1c916e456f935671af3b87a68b60634e3eeca72ec868df25b7f7a5761e6:1

value
74080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23c0bdcf4109eea63dd44bdd418a6a7cb4307e9 OP_EQUAL
address
ABbtVmSQScHZ5jWXTqPZoFHPksF9gy5Qas
transaction
96a5e1c916e456f935671af3b87a68b60634e3eeca72ec868df25b7f7a5761e6